Looking at how Archimedes discovered his principle during a bath and thinking about if King Hiero’s crown was actually made of pure gold, the following quantities can be given. The crown weighed 3.55 kg (f= 34.8 N) in air and 3.25 kg (f= 31.9 N) in water. With the density of gold being 19,300 kg/m3. How would I determine if the crown is made of pure gold, without weighing the crown in water an instead using an ordinary bucket with no calibration for volume?
